2014-05-20 6 views
2

Я использую Google Analytics SDK v4 для Android для регистрации исключений. Я последовал примеру приложения, но я не видел никаких исключений, зарегистрированных на панели управления.Google Analytics для регистрации в Google Analytics

Я написал код, как показано ниже

/*exception tracking */ 
// Get tracker. 
Tracker t2 = 
    ((MyApp) this.getApplication()).getTracker(TrackerName.APP_TRACKER); 

// Build and send exception. 
int a = 0; 
String exceptionStr = ""; 

try{ 
    int b = a/0; 
}catch(Exception ex){ 
    exceptionStr = ex.toString(); 
}finally{ 
    t2.send(new HitBuilders.ExceptionBuilder() 
      .setDescription(exceptionStr + ":" + "In Main screen") 
      .setFatal(true) 
      .build()); 

    GoogleAnalytics.getInstance(this.getApplicationContext()).dispatchLocalHits(); 

    Log.v("Manual logging", "finished for analytics"); 
} 

"Manual logging", "finished for analytics" показывает в окне LogCat, но когда я проверяю аналитику нет ничего зарегистрировано.

BTW пользовательский экран и т. Д., Работающий только с SDK. Просто журнал регистрации не работает.

+4

Google Analytics берет ДО 24 часа, чтобы отразить обновления в панели мониторинга. Если вы хотите просмотреть текущие изменения, то вам нужно использовать функции реального времени в Goolge Analytics. –

+0

Вы правы, теперь появляются исключения :) – user3296042

+0

Это было полезно - но для этого нужен официальный ответ. Я поставил его, но если @Siddharth_Vyas хочет сделать своего чиновника, я проголосую за него. – QED

ответ

0

Данные могут появиться на панели инструментов GoogleAnalytics. Дайте ему некоторое время, оно появится за исключениями.

0

Это работает для меня, но я использую advanced crash report implementation.

Перейти к Behavior -> Сбои & Исключения

В правом верхнем раскрывающемся списке (ниже селектора диапазонов дат), выберите «более быстрый отклик, менее Precision» вариант вместо «Более медленный отклик по умолчанию , большая точность»:

Faster Response, less Precision

Кроме того, дополнительно, вы можете нажать на "Обновить отчет" но тонны в нижнем правом углу, если последние сообщили генерируемой несвежая:

"Refresh Report"

Если ни один из вышеупомянутых работ, а затем ждать в течение 24 часов для GA генерировать отчеты :)

Смежные вопросы